Mike interviews Nick ShepherdWelcome to a thought-provoking episode of our podcast, where we explore the profound impact of workplace culture on financial performance. In this episode, our host, Mike, interviews Nick Shepherd, the esteemed author of "The Cost of Poor Culture: The massive financial opportunity in an enhanced workplace climate." This episode is essential listening for leaders, managers, and anyone invested in the health and success of their organization.Nick Shepherd is a seasoned consultant, speaker, and author with extensive experience in organizational development and culture transformation. His book, "The Cost of Poor Culture: The massive financial opportunity in an enhanced workplace climate," offers a compelling examination of how poor workplace culture can drain financial resources and hinder growth. With a focus on actionable strategies, Nick provides a roadmap for creating a positive, high-performing workplace environment.Nick Shepherd begins by unpacking the concept of workplace culture and its direct link to financial performance. He explains how a toxic or poor culture can lead to decreased productivity, higher turnover rates, and increased operational costs. By highlighting these hidden costs, Nick sets the stage for a discussion on the significant financial opportunities that come with enhancing workplace culture.Throughout the episode, Nick outlines the telltale signs of a poor workplace culture. From low employee morale and engagement to frequent conflicts and communication breakdowns, he provides listeners with the tools to diagnose cultural issues within their own organizations. Understanding these symptoms is the first step towards implementing meaningful change.One of the central themes of "The Cost of Poor Culture: The massive financial opportunity in an enhanced workplace climate" is the substantial return on investment (ROI) that organizations can achieve by prioritizing culture. Nick shares compelling data and case studies that demonstrate how companies with strong, positive cultures outperform their peers. He emphasizes that investing in culture is not just a feel-good initiative but a strategic business decision that can drive financial success.Nick delves into practical strategies for building and sustaining a positive workplace culture. He discusses the importance of leadership commitment, clear communication, and consistent reinforcement of values and behaviors. Listeners will learn how to create an environment where employees feel valued, supported, and motivated to contribute their best work.Another critical aspect covered in the episode is the measurement of cultural change. Nick provides insights into the metrics and tools that organizations can use to assess the effectiveness of their culture initiatives. From employee surveys to performance indicators, he offers practical advice on how to track progress and make data-driven decisions.Throughout the conversation, Mike and Nick explore real-world applications of the principles discussed in "The Cost of Poor Culture: The massive financial opportunity in an enhanced workplace climate." They talk about organizations that have successfully transformed their cultures and the tangible benefits they have realized. These examples serve as powerful inspiration for listeners, showing that cultural change is not only possible but also highly rewarding.For leaders looking to take action, Nick offers a wealth of practical tips and advice. He covers everything from conducting a cultural audit and engaging employees in the change process to aligning culture with business strategy and sustaining momentum over the long term.
